Output e6d2367146f4b836c11c39d98a7915e4f43b9776eb468907683f01d0c53f3181:17

value
164095271
script pubkey
OP_0 OP_PUSHBYTES_20 ff4563fba75c3265805e53b9ca95f7aede8124a2
address
ltc1qlazk87a8tsextqz72wuu490h4m0gzf9z5ulflq
transaction
e6d2367146f4b836c11c39d98a7915e4f43b9776eb468907683f01d0c53f3181
spent
true